The genome sequence of the Large Blue butterfly, Phengaris (Maculinea) arion (Linnaeus, 1758)

Abstract:
We present a genome assembly from a female Phengaris arion (the Large Blue butterfly; Arthropoda; Insecta; Lepidoptera; Lycaenidae). The genome sequence is 544.50 megabases in length. Most of the assembly is scaffolded into 23 chromosomal pseudomolecules, including the Z sex chromosome. The mitochondrial genome has also been assembled and is 15.7 kilobases in length.
